Japanese Grand Prix
The Formula 1 schedule moves into a more convenient time slot for those on the East coast, with the Japanese Grand Prix this weekend. Sebastian Vettel's title is all but wrapped up, and a decent result here would see him confirmed as the 2011 World Champion. Recent history suggests he will do so, with the German driver having won the race from pole position last year. Behind Vettel is a huge scrap for second place, with the battle between McLaren-Mercedes team mates Hamilton and Button arguably the most interesting. The driver standings are currently as follows:
1 Sebastian Vettel (RBR-Renault) 309
2 Jenson Button (McLaren-Mercedes) 185
3 Fernando Alonso (Ferrari) 184
4 Mark Webber (RBR-Renault) 182
5 Lewis Hamilton (McLaren-Mercedes) 168
6 Felipe Massa (Ferrari) 84
7 Nico Rosberg (Mercedes) 62
8 Michael Schumacher (Mercedes) 52
